Question 491520: 28/42 - 2\5 =??
Answer by rfer(16322) (Show Source): You can put this solution on YOUR website!
FOR EASE OF OPERATION,
REDUCE 28/42 TO 2/3,
then find the common denominator
2/3-2/5=
10/15-6/15=4/15
